The Master's program in Foreign and Regional Languages, Literatures, and Civilizations (LLCER) comprises four tracks: - Hispanic and Latin American Studies (EHH): training in Spanish language, literature, and culture. - Anglophone World Studies (EMA), including two sub-tracks: Research and Competitive Examination for Teacher Certification in English, and Training in Civilization, Linguistics, Literature, and Translation Studies. - Italian Language and Culture (LCI): training in Italian language, literature, and culture; preparation for the Competitive Examination for Teacher Certification in Italian. - Transadaptation: Subtitling and Dubbing of Film and Audiovisual Productions (TSD), an alternative to teaching and research careers, preparing students for a career as a translator-adapter of audiovisual productions (Master 2 only).
